Jun 17, 2022 · Futures spread is a trading strategy that seeks to profit from the price difference between two futures contracts with the same underlying asset but different settlement dates. Futures spreads are formed when a trader takes opposite positions in the futures market at the same time — i.e., buying one futures contract and selling another. Futures are derivative contracts to buy or sell an asset at a future date at an agreed-upon price. Crypto has 5X the volatility of traditional asset classes.WebBreakout trading is a futures swing trading strategy that enables the swing trader to profit from market trends. A breakout occurs when an underlying asset’s price moves past a support or resistance zone. Case 1: Investor X buys 1 lot of Reliance May 2018 futures at a price of Rs.968. However, since he believes that there could be downside risk on the stock, he also buys a 960 May 2018 put option at Rs.8. To reduce the cost of the put option, the investor also sells a 980 ...
